Greetings,

I am planning a trip to Truk with the Odyssey Liveaboard later this year in December. I am wondering if the liveaboard supports sidemount divers for deco diving? Additionally, do I need to pay extra for extra stage/deco cylinders?

What's the average run time that they will allow you for each dive?
 
yes they do. tanks are not charged extra (standard al80s and al40s) but you need to bring your own rigging.

run times are not restricted, but if you try to do like 4 hours of deco, they will ask you to keep it within reason so they can keep to the schedule unless if a double dip is planned or you are on a charter that is setting a custom itinerary

Amazing! Love it when they can happily accommodate tech divers. Haha definitely not doing 4hour deco, but would like to extend my diving beyond rec diving a bit if possible given this place is so hard to get to.

People who I am going to this liveaboard with are all rec diver (from the dive shop), I was hoping I can find a likeminded tech buddy on board, do you reckon it’s going to be possible?
 
is your shop chartering the boat? generally you won't get randoms in that case so it would have to be someone through your LDS. the guides will only do a limited amount of deco, so the deeper wrecks you will be planning and carrying out your own dives. part of the problem is helium is crazy expensive in Chuuk and you will need to plan on something like 6 dollars a cf.
